--------------- ubuntu-themes (14.04+14.04.20140311-0ubuntu1) trusty; urgency=medium [ Didier Roche ] * Install the new suru icon theme in its own binary package * Bump standards-version [ Lars Uebernickel ] * Don't set toolbar's background to transparent Evolution uses the toolbar's background color for the frame in its mail view. A transparent background will make that appear black. * Give the .view class a background Fixes black background in the dnd widgets when dragging a GtkTreeView row. * Set gtk-alternative-sort-arrows to true The triangles used by the themes convey sort order better when flipped (pointing up is ascending). (LP: #901703) * Add margin to popup menus to prevent accidental clicks Gtk displaces the menus based on the margin. A margin of 1px ensures that the mouse pointer is not over the first (or last) menu item after right- clicking. (LP: #1281617) * Move .view class background further up So that the .rubberband rules come after it. * Fix black backgrounds in glade and baobab The black backgrounds only appear when using overlay-scrollbars. These are hacks to work around limitations in gtk 3.10. * Fix linked button appearance The left-most buttons in primary toolbars didn't have a left border and the middle buttons had borders when the window was unfocussed. (LP: #1290501) [ Matthieu James ] * This is the new icon theme for Ubuntu Touch.
